isxconcat-sess creates the files that you pass to mri_glmfit (ie, multi-frame volumes and/or surfaces where each frame is a subject). Something like:
AVG08/Analyse_Simple_Confidence/High_confidence__Low_confidence_vs_HSF_gabor__LSF_gabor/tal.ces.nii
You can then use this as input to mri_glmfit passing it with the --y option. You can get more help from the FS FAST tutorial. Go to the wiki, type "isxconcat-sess" in the Search field, then hit the "Text" button.
